Ingredients and spices that need to be Prepare to make Chana chaat plate:
- 1 kg chana boiled
- 2 tomatoes
- 1 onion
- Coriander leaves handful
- 2 tbspn Chaat masala
- Salt to taste
- Mint leaves
- Soak imli.
Steps to make Chana chaat plate
- Soak chana over night. and boil them
- In a bowl add, chopped onions, tomatoes and salt coriander n mints leaves green chillies chopped and chaat masala and imli mixture..
Mix all together n enjoy your iftar
